By now I'm sure you've heard of Intelligent Design, which focuses on alleged irreducible complexity, and perhaps even Incompetent Design, which focuses on the mysterious designer's shoddy handiwork, but have you heard of Malevolent Design? This takes ID and turns it on it's head. The Intelligent Design Creationists always love to focus on the benevolent to be found in nature such as a flagellum or an eye. But why stop there? Why, unless you are intentionally avoiding the negative in order to preserve an image of deity that loves everyone? Why not take things a bit further and look at the flip side of the equation? Seeing as I lack belief in all gods and goddesses and have no such agenda to preserve anything about their alleged personalities, I shall delve full into this fascinating mythological concept.
Malevolent Design (hereafter MD), simply put, is the secondary negative quality that one should see if one first sees intelligence. If there be a master designer then one should be able to gauge how he feels about his creations by the interaction between them. There various body parts should spell out he/she/them/it's intentions. Are we the darlings of a deity or merely part of an experiment led by a pantheon of gods on Lab Earth? Are we no more than white mice to be toyed with in order to test out new MDs and their effectiveness?
Mosquitoes have a special facial appendage known as a proboscis. This appendage has six parts, two pairs of cutters for opening up the skin of the victim and two fine tubes. One is for sucking up blood and the other is for dripping in anticoagulant, which keeps the blood from clotting. Why would a benevolent designer create such a little monster? And why, for their traveling companion would said designer create special pathogens to go along with it?
Mosquitoes carry many diseases. They include Malaria, West Nile virus, Dengue Fever, Encephalitis and Yellow Fever. All of these diseases kill indiscriminately, cutting swaths through the young and old, especially in third world countries. Death from these is neither quick nor pleasant. They kill regardless of religion, race or social status. The believer and Atheist can die just the same without medical treatment. Why would the mysterious designer create these tiny beings? To watch us die slow, torturous deaths? To see if he/she/them/it could overcome the immune system that he/she/them/it designed previously, kind of like a hacker breaking into his own program?
Carnivores have sharp teeth, perfect for cutting flesh, a strong digestive system perfect for digesting meat and various other body parts that aid them in acquiring their victims. A great white shark, for example, has rows upon rows of very sharp, serrated teeth that, when lost, turn to replace the old ones. They can smell minute traces of blood in the water from miles away. It would appear to show excellent signs of MD! Is it too far off to assume the designer wants his other creations, upon entering the water, to be eaten by this beast if given a chance?
There are countless other examples I could cite to show the prevalence of the neglected obvious but these few examples prove my point: if you believe you see intelligence, there is malevolence right along with it!
